Maison >interface Web >Voir.js >Compétences en gestion de données et en gestion d'état dans le développement de Vue
Vue est un framework front-end populaire largement utilisé dans le développement d'applications Web modernes. Dans le développement de Vue, la gestion des données et la gestion des états sont très importantes. Cet article présentera certaines techniques de gestion des données et de gestion des états dans le développement de Vue pour aider les développeurs à mieux appliquer Vue.
1. Compétences en gestion des données
data
avant l'attribut data. , lorsque les données réactives changent, les vues associées seront automatiquement mises à jour. Cette approche peut simplifier la gestion des données et améliorer l’efficacité du développement. data
关键字将数据变成响应式数据,这样当响应式数据发生变化时,相关的视图会自动更新。这种方式可以简化数据的管理,并提高开发效率。watch
属性中定义需要监视的数据,当数据发生变化时,可以执行相应的操作,例如发送请求、更新视图等。state
来管理数据,通过getter
来获取数据,通过mutation
Utilisez Watch pour surveiller les modifications des données : en plus des propriétés calculées, Vue fournit également un mécanisme de surveillance pour surveiller les modifications des données. En définissant les données qui doivent être surveillées dans l'attribut watch
, lorsque les données changent, vous pouvez effectuer les opérations correspondantes, telles que l'envoi de requêtes, la mise à jour des vues, etc.
state
, en obtenant les données via getter
et en modifiant les données via mutation
. Assurer la cohérence des données et. maintenabilité. Utilisez des événements personnalisés : en plus des accessoires, Vue fournit également un mécanisme d'événements personnalisés pour établir la communication entre les composants. En déclenchant des événements personnalisés dans les composants enfants, le composant parent peut écouter et gérer les événements en conséquence pour réaliser la synchronisation et la communication des données.
🎜Utilisation des emplacements : les emplacements dans Vue sont un mécanisme permettant de définir du contenu extensible dans les composants. En utilisant des emplacements, les composants parents peuvent contrôler le contenu d'affichage des composants enfants, obtenant ainsi une gestion des données et une gestion de l'état plus flexibles. 🎜🎜🎜Pour résumer, pour la gestion des données et la gestion des statuts dans le développement de Vue, nous pouvons améliorer l'efficacité du développement en utilisant des techniques telles que les données réactives, les propriétés calculées et Watch pour surveiller les modifications des données. Pour les applications à grande échelle, Vuex peut être utilisé pour une gestion centralisée des données. De plus, des techniques telles que la division rationnelle des composants, l'utilisation de Props pour transmettre des données, des événements et des emplacements personnalisés peuvent également nous aider à mieux gérer l'état. J'espère que ces conseils pourront être utiles aux développeurs Vue. 🎜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!